Project Overview

We were delighted to collaborate with the Mount Elephant community, to deliver a new visitor centre at one of the region’s most recognisable landmarks. The building was sited atop the original floor of the old quarry and was constructed from rammed earth. Its natural, earthy aesthetic blends seamlessly with the surrounding landscape, offering shelter for visitors and features displays with large windows that provide a spectacular view of the mountain and its surrounding landscape.

Project Success & Impact

The sustainable building has a modern design that serves also as a tourism centre and community meeting space, allowing for different occasions to easily be held in the building. Building with rammed earth was a unique but rewarding experience for MKM, given its multiple advantages including superior thermal mass, temperature and noise control, strength and durability, low maintenance, fire proofing, load-bearing, and pest deterrence. Additionally it holds significant aesthetic appeal and is a satisfying building material due to its natural and environmental qualities.
